Как вставить несколько строк в Excel: полное руководство

Работа с большими массивами данных в табличном редакторе часто требует оперативного изменения структуры документа. Пользователи регулярно сталкиваются с необходимостью добавить новые записи между уже существующими, чтобы сохранить логическую последовательность или просто расширить список. Стандартная процедура добавления одной ячейки или строки знакома многим, однако вставка сразу нескольких строк требует понимания определенных нюансов интерфейса.

Существует множество способов выполнить эту задачу, от классического использования контекстного меню до применения горячих клавиш для ускорения процесса. Выбор метода зависит от того, сколько именно строк вам нужно добавить и как часто вы планируете это делать в ходе работы над Microsoft Excel. Правильное использование инструментов редактирования позволяет значительно сократить время, затрачиваемое на форматирование таблиц.

В этой статье мы подробно разберем все актуальные способы вставки, включая скрытые функции и приемы, полезные для продвинутых пользователей. Вы узнаете, как быстро создать интервалы между данными, продублировать существующие строки или добавить пустые места для будущих записей. Освоение этих техник сделает вашу работу с электронными таблицами более эффективной и профессиональной.

Классический метод через контекстное меню

Самый распространенный и понятный способ для новичков — использование правой кнопки мыши. Этот метод позволяет визуально контролировать процесс и выбирать конкретные параметры вставки. Для начала необходимо выделить строки, над которыми будут добавлены новые ячейки. Если вам нужно вставить три строки, выделите три существующие строки в таблице.

После выделения нажмите правую кнопку мыши в любом месте выделенной области. В появившемся меню выберите пункт Вставить. Система автоматически сдвинет существующие данные вниз, освободив место для новых записей.

⚠️ Внимание: Если в выделенных ячейках содержались формулы, зависящие от соседних диапазонов, после вставки новых строк ссылки могут сместиться. Проверьте корректность вычислений в затронутых областях.

Этот метод особенно удобен, когда вы работаете с неравномерными данными и вам нужно внимательно следить за тем, куда именно вставляется пустое пространство. Он также позволяет избежать случайных ошибок, которые могут возникнуть при использовании горячих клавиш, если пальцы соскользнут с клавиатуры.

📊 Какой метод вставки строк вы используете чаще всего?
Контекстное меню (ПКМ)
Горячие клавиши (Ctrl++)
Через ленту меню
Макросы/VBA

Использование горячих клавиш для ускорения работы

Для тех, кто ценит скорость и эффективность, незаменимым инструментом станут комбинации клавиш. Они позволяют выполнять операции без отрыва рук от клавиатуры, что особенно важно при интенсивном вводе данных. Чтобы воспользоваться этим методом, сначала выделите нужное количество строк, используя зажатую клавишу Shift и стрелки навигации.

После выделения нажмите комбинацию Ctrl + + (плюс на цифровой клавиатуре или Ctrl + Shift + = на обычной клавиатуре). На экране появится диалоговое окно, где необходимо выбрать опцию Строку и нажать Enter. Это действие мгновенно добавит пустые ячейки в нужном месте.

  • 🚀 Выделите строки, над которыми нужно вставить новые.
  • ⌨️ Нажмите Ctrl + Shift + = для вызова меню вставки.
  • 📂 Выберите направление сдвига ячеек (строку) и подтвердите действие.
  • 🔄 Повторяйте комбинацию F4 для повторения последней операции вставки.

Использование горячих клавиш требует некоторой практики, но результат того стоит. Профессионалы используют этот метод для мгновенного расширения таблиц во время анализа данных. Клавиша F4 здесь играет роль повторителя последнего действия, что позволяет добавлять строки пачками без повторного выделения.

Вставка строк с интервалами для группировки данных

Часто возникает задача не просто добавить строки в конец или начало, а создать отступы между каждой существующей строкой для лучшей читаемости или печати. Стандартными методами это делать долго, но есть хитрый прием с сортировкой. Сначала создайте вспомогательный столбец рядом с вашими данными и пронумеруйте строки от 1 до N.

Затем продублируйте этот столбец ниже, добавив к номерам дробную часть (например, 1.1, 2.1, 3.1) или просто скопировав номера, если структура позволяет. После сортировки этого вспомогательного столбца по возрастанию, ваши исходные данные разделятся пустыми строками. Это уникальный трюк, позволяющий автоматизировать процесс создания интервалов.

Шаг Действие Результат
1 Создать столбец с номерами 1, 2, 3.. Порядок сохранен
2 Добавить строки с номерами 1.5, 2.5, 3.5.. Появились пустые места
3 Отсортировать по числовому столбцу Данные разделены пустотой

Этот метод особенно полезен при подготовке отчетов для печати, где требуется визуальное разделение блоков информации. Он избавляет от необходимости вручную добавлять пустоту после каждой записи, что при больших объемах данных заняло бы часы. Главное здесь — правильно настроить сортировку, чтобы не перемешать сами данные.

Как восстановить исходный порядок после сортировки?

Если вы не удаляли исходный столбец с номерами, просто отсортируйте таблицу по нему еще раз. Если удалили — используйте функцию "Отменить" (Ctrl+Z) сразу после сортировки, пока не сделали других действий.

Копирование и дублирование существующих строк

В некоторых случаях требуется не просто вставить пустое место, а продублировать шаблон строки или конкретные данные несколько раз. Для этого выделите строку, которую нужно скопировать, и зажмите клавишу Ctrl. Переместите курсор на границу выделенной области, пока он не изменится на значок с плюсиком.

Зажмите левую кнопку мыши и перетащите выделение вниз или вверх. Excel автоматически создаст копии выбранной строки. Этот метод называется Drag-and-Drop и является очень наглядным. Количество созданных копий будет зависеть от того, сколько строк вы перетащите курсором.

Альтернативный вариант — использовать буфер обмена. Выделите строки, нажмите Ctrl + C, затем выделите место вставки и нажмите Ctrl + V. Если нужно вставить данные несколько раз, можно выделить диапазон ячеек, превышающий размер буфера, и вставить — данные размножатся на весь выделенный диапазон.

  • 📋 Выделите исходную строку или диапазон.
  • ✂️ Скопируйте данные через Ctrl + C.
  • 📍 Выделите целевую область (можно больше, чем исходник).
  • 📥 Вставьте через Ctrl + V для заполнения.

При копировании строк важно обращать внимание на абсолютные и относительные ссылки в формулах. При перетаскивании мышью ссылки могут измениться автоматически, а при вставке через буфер обмена — остаться прежними, в зависимости от настроек. Всегда проверяйте логику формул после массового копирования.

☑️ Проверка после дублирования строк

Выполнено: 0 / 4

Работа с форматированием при вставке строк

Одной из частых проблем является потеря форматирования при добавлении новых строк. Excel обладает интеллектуальной функцией, которая пытается угадать, как нужно оформить новую область, основываясь на соседних ячейках. Однако это работает не всегда идеально, особенно если таблица имеет сложную структуру.

Если новая строка появилась без границ или цвета фона, используйте инструмент Формат по образцу. Выделите соседнюю оформленную строку, нажмите на иконку кисти в меню или используйте сочетание Ctrl + Shift + C (копирование формата) и Ctrl + Shift + V (вставка формата). Это быстро приведет новую строку к общему виду.

⚠️ Внимание: При вставке строк внутри таблицы, оформленной как "Умная таблица" (Ctrl+T), форматирование и формулы обычно копируются автоматически. В обычных диапазонах этого может не произойти.

Для поддержания единообразия документа рекомендуется использовать стили ячеек. Если вы примените стиль к строке до её копирования или вставки, новые данные будут выглядеть профессионально. Это особенно актуально для корпоративных отчетов, где важен визуальный стандарт.

Автоматизация через макросы для больших объемов

Когда требуется вставлять строки в огромных файлах по сложному алгоритму, ручные методы становятся неэффективными. Здесь на помощь приходит язык программирования VBA (Visual Basic for Applications). С помощью макроса можно прописать условие, например: "если в столбце А стоит слово 'Важно', вставить строку выше".

Код для такого макроса может быть довольно простым. Он проходит циклом по строкам листа и выполняет команду Rows(i).Insert при выполнении условия. Это позволяет обрабатывать тысячи строк за считанные секунды. Для запуска макросов используется вкладка Разработчик или сочетание клавиш Alt + F11.

Sub InsertRowsBasedOnCondition()

Dim i As Long

For i = Cells(Rows.Count, 1).End(xlUp).Row To 2 Step -1

If Cells(i, 1).Value = "Важно" Then

Rows(i).Insert

End If

Next i

End Sub

Использование автоматизации требует осторожности, так как действие макроса сложно отменить стандартной кнопкой "Назад". Перед запуском скрипта обязательно сохраните копию файла. Это защитит вас от потери данных в случае ошибки в логике программы.

Освоение базовых принципов макросов открывает новые горизонты в работе с Excel. Даже если вы не программист, использование готовых сниппетов кода для вставки строк может сэкономить вам десятки часов работы в месяц. Это переход от пользователя к эксперту.

Часто задаваемые вопросы (FAQ)

Как вставить строки сразу во всем выделенном диапазоне?

Выделите строки, соответствующие количеству вставляемых. Нажмите правую кнопку мыши и выберите "Вставить". Excel добавит строки над каждой выделенной строкой, если вы выделяли их по одной через Ctrl, или добавит блок строк, если выделение было сплошным.

Почему при вставке строк сбиваются формулы?

Это происходит, если в формулах использовались абсолютные ссылки без закрепления или если вставляемая строка разрывает диапазон, на который ссылается функция. Используйте функцию ДВССЫЛ или проверяйте ссылки после вставки.

Можно ли вставить строку посередине_merged_ячейки?

Нет, Excel не позволит вставить строки, если выделение пересекает объединенную ячейку. Сначала необходимо снять объединение (Объединить и поместить в центре), вставить строки, а затем объединить ячейки заново.

Как быстро добавить 100 пустых строк?

Выделите 100 существующих строк (введите диапазон в адресную строку, например A1:A100, и нажмите Enter), затем нажмите Ctrl++ и выберите "Строку". Или введите номер строки, зажмите Shift, введите номер строки + 100, нажмите Enter и выберите "Вставить".